The aim of this trial is to investigate the efficacy of trigger point injections with 1% lidocaine in reducing myofascial back and neck pain in the Emergency Department compared to lidocaine patches 5%.
After being informed about the study and the potential risks and benefits, all patients will be randomized into either the trigger point injection group with 1% lidocaine, or the 5% lidocaine patch group. Pain scores will be recorded while in the emergency department, and we will have a 5 day follow-up phone call to assess efficacy. Patients who present to UCI Department of Emergency medicine will be screened and recruited prospectively, and information regarding this study will be available on clinicaltrials.gov as a method of recruitment.

| Trigger point with 1% Lidocaine | Experimental | The physician will withdraw 1cc of 1% lidocaine in a 25g needle, sterilely prep the field with a Chloraprep applicator, use index, and middle finger to squeeze the borders of the trigger point and raise the central aspect of the trigger point, insert the needle at 90-degree angle up to 5/8' deep, inject 1cc of the 1% lidocaine after ensuring needle is not in a blood vessel, removing the needle, and then covering the insertion site with a sterile bandage. |

This will be a single-center, prospective, randomized, pragmatic trial carried out with patients that have a primary complaint of myofascial back and/or posterior neck pain. Upon presentation to the emergency department, if the patient is found to have myofascial pain, they will be approached by research personnel to be enrolled in the study. If the patient consents to be in the study, the patient will then be randomly assigned to either receive a trigger point injection or receive lidocaine patch (5%) therapy. The lidocaine patch therapy group cannot receive a trigger point injection. Randomization will occur in blocks of 2, using a Web- based randomization program (http://sealedenvelope.com).

Given the trigger point injection is physician performed, and very different from placing a lidocaine patch, we cannot blind investigators nor the patient to the intervention. We will, however, blind our outcome assessors in regards to which intervention the patient had received.
